动态VPS是什么?如何选择?实用指南
卡尔云官网
www.kaeryun.com
在现代网络安全和云计算领域,动态VPS(Dynamic Virtual Private Server)是一种灵活且高效的解决方案,本文将为你详细解释动态VPS是什么,如何选择适合的动态VPS服务,以及如何在实际应用中使用它。
什么是动态VPS?
动态VPS是指一种能够根据实际负载自动调整资源的虚拟服务器,与传统VPS不同,传统VPS提供固定的资源配置,如内存、存储和CPU,而动态VPS可以根据实时需求动态调整这些资源,以优化性能并降低成本。
为什么需要动态VPS?
- 资源优化:动态VPS可以根据当前负载自动调整资源,避免资源浪费。
- 成本控制:在高峰期增加资源,低谷期减少资源,降低长期成本。
- 高可用性:自动调整资源有助于提升服务器稳定性,减少停机时间。
- 弹性扩展:适用于动态变化的业务需求,如电商网站或SaaS平台。
动态VPS的工作原理
动态VPS通过监控服务器的负载情况,自动分配和释放资源。
- 在高负载时,动态VPS会增加内存或CPU资源。
- 在低负载时,动态VPS会减少资源使用,释放占用的空间。
如何选择动态VPS?
选择适合的提供商
动态VPS服务提供商通常提供自动调整资源的解决方案,以下是一些知名的选择:
- AWS EC2:亚马逊的弹性计算服务,支持按需扩展。
- 阿里云Elastic云服务器:支持自动调整资源,适合国内用户。
- DigitalOcean:简单易用,提供多种弹性服务。
- Google Cloud Compute Engine:支持自动调整资源,适合开发者。
- Cloudflare:提供弹性云服务,适合需要高可用性的场景。
评估监控功能
动态VPS需要实时监控资源使用情况,以确保自动调整功能正常工作,选择提供商时,应查看其监控工具是否集成,如Prometheus、Nagios等。
考虑管理与支持
选择提供商时,注意其技术支持和管理功能,好的动态VPS服务提供商通常提供24/7技术支持,确保在出现问题时能够快速解决。
选择适合的资源分配策略
不同的业务需求需要不同的资源分配策略,电商网站可能需要高内存和高CPU资源,而游戏服务器可能需要高CPU资源。
动态VPS的实施步骤
确定需求
明确你的业务需求,包括负载波动情况、峰值负载、以及对资源调整的响应时间。
选择提供商
根据需求和预算选择合适的提供商,并查看其服务条款和用户评价。
部署服务
通过提供商的控制面板或API部署动态VPS,大多数提供商提供简单的控制面板,方便用户管理。
监控与优化
部署后,使用提供商提供的监控工具实时监控资源使用情况,根据监控数据调整资源分配策略,以优化性能和降低成本。
部署到生产环境
在测试通过后,将动态VPS部署到生产环境,确保其稳定运行。
动态VPS的注意事项
- 资源过度使用:动态VPS会根据负载自动调整资源,但如果资源分配策略不当,可能导致资源过度使用,影响服务器性能。
- 备份与恢复:动态VPS可能会影响备份和恢复策略,需要谨慎处理。
- 安全设置:动态VPS可能增加服务器的安全风险,需要加强安全措施,如使用HTTPS、定期更新软件等。
动态VPS是一种灵活且高效的解决方案,能够根据业务需求自动调整资源,优化性能并降低成本,选择合适的动态VPS服务提供商,合理配置资源分配策略,并结合监控与优化,能够充分发挥动态VPS的优势。
卡尔云官网
www.kaeryun.com